1 Ακουε, Ισραηλ· συ διαβαινεις σημερον τον Ιορδανην, δια να εισελθης να κληρονομησης εθνη μεγαλητερα και ισχυροτερα σου, πολεις μεγαλας και τετειχισμενας εως του ουρανου,

2 λαον μεγαν και υψηλον το αναστημα, υιους των Ανακειμ, τους οποιους γνωριζεις και ηκουσας, Τις δυναται να σταθη εμπροσθεν των υιων του Ανακ;

3 Γνωρισον λοιπον σημερον, οτι Κυριος ο Θεος σου ειναι ο προπορευομενος εμπροσθεν σου· ειναι πυρ καταναλισκον· αυτος θελει εξολοθρευσει αυτους και αυτος θελει καταστρεψει αυτους απ' εμπροσθεν σου· και θελεις εκδιωξει αυτους και ταχεως εξολοθρευσει αυτους, καθως σοι ειπεν ο Κυριος.

4 Αφου Κυριος ο Θεος σου εκδιωξη αυτους απ' εμπροσθεν σου, μη ειπης εν τη καρδια σου λεγων, Δια την δικαιοσυνην μου με εισηγαγεν ο Κυριος να κληρονομησω την γην ταυτην· αλλα δια την ασεβειαν των εθνων τουτων εκδιωκει αυτους ο Κυριος απ' εμπροσθεν σου.

5 Ουχι δια την δικαιοσυνην σου ουδε δια την ευθυτητα της καρδιας σου εισερχεσαι να κληρονομησης την γην αυτων· αλλα δια την ασεβειαν των εθνων τουτων Κυριος ο Θεος σου εκδιωκει αυτα απ' εμπροσθεν σου, και δια να στερεωση τον λογον, τον οποιον ο Κυριος ωμοσε προς τους πατερας σου, προς τον Αβρααμ, προς τον Ισαακ και προς τον Ιακωβ.

6 Γνωρισον λοιπον, οτι Κυριος ο Θεος σου δεν σοι διδει την γην ταυτην την αγαθην να κληρονομησης αυτην δια την δικαιοσυνην σου· διοτι εισαι λαος σκληροτραχηλος.

7 Ενθυμου, μη λησμονησης ποσον παρωργισας Κυριον τον Θεον σου εν τη ερημω αφ' ης ημερας εξηλθετε εκ γης Αιγυπτου, εωσου εφθασατε εις τον τοπον τουτον, παντοτε εστασιασατε κατα του Κυριου.

8 Και εν Χωρηβ παρωργισατε τον Κυριον και εθυμωθη ο Κυριος εναντιον σας δια να σας εξολοθρευση,

9 οτε ανεβην εις το ορος δια να λαβω τας πλακας τας λιθινας, τας πλακας της διαθηκης την οποιαν ο Κυριος εκαμε προς εσας. Τοτε εμεινα εν τω ορει τεσσαρακοντα ημερας και τεσσαρακοντα νυκτας· αρτον δεν εφαγον και υδωρ δεν επιον·

10 και εδωκεν εις εμε ο Κυριος τας δυο λιθινας πλακας, γεγραμμενας δια του δακτυλου του Θεου· και επ' αυτας ησαν γεγραμμενοι παντες οι λογοι, τους οποιους ελαλησεν ο Κυριος προς εσας επι του ορους εκ μεσου του πυρος εν τη ημερα της συναξεως.

11 Και εις το τελος των τεσσαρακοντα ημερων και τεσσαρακοντα νυκτων εδωκεν εις εμε ο Κυριος τας δυο λιθινας πλακας, τας πλακας της διαθηκης.

12 Και ειπε Κυριος προς εμε, Σηκωθητι, καταβα ταχεως εντευθεν· διοτι ο λαος σου, τον οποιον εξηγαγες εξ Αιγυπτου, ηνομησεν· ταχεως εξεκλιναν απο της οδου, την οποιαν προσεταξα εις αυτους· εκαμον εις εαυτους ειδωλον χυτον.

13 Ειπεν οτι ο Κυριος προς εμε, λεγων, Ειδον τον λαον τουτον και ιδου, ειναι λαος σκληροτραχηλος·

14 αφες με να εξολοθρευσω αυτους και να εξαλειψω το ονομα αυτων υποκατωθεν του ουρανου· και θελω σε καμει εις εθνος δυνατωτερον και μεγαλητερον παρα τουτους.

15 Και επεστρεψα και κατεβην απο του ορους, και το ορος εκαιετο με πυρ, και αι δυο πλακες της διαθηκης ησαν εις τας δυο χειρας μου.

16 Και ειδον και ιδου, ειχετε αμαρτησει εναντιον Κυριου του Θεου σας, καμνοντες εις εαυτους μοσχον χυτον· ειχετε εκκλινει ταχεως εκ της οδου, την οποιαν προσεταξεν εις εσας ο Κυριος·

17 και πιασας τας δυο πλακας, ερριψα αυτας απο των δυο χειρων μου και συνετριψα αυτας εμπροσθεν των οφθαλμων σας·

18 και προσεπεσον ενωπιον του Κυριου, καθως προτερον, τεσσαρακοντα ημερας και τεσσαρακοντα νυκτας· αρτον δεν εφαγον και υδωρ δεν επιον εξ αιτιας πασων των αμαρτιων σας, τας οποιας ημαρτησατε, πραττοντες πονηρα ενωπιον του Κυριου, ωστε να παροργισητε αυτον·

19 διοτι κατεφοβηθην δια τον θυμον και την οργην, με την οποιαν ο Κυριος ητο θυμωμενος εναντιον σας δια να σας εξολοθρευση. Αλλ' ο Κυριος εισηκουσε μου και ταυτην την φοραν.

20 Και ητο ο Κυριος θυμωμενος σφοδρα κατα του Ααρων, δια να εξολοθρευση αυτον· και εδεηθην και υπερ του Ααρων εν τω καιρω εκεινω.

21 Και ελαβον την αμαρτιαν σας, τον μοσχον τον οποιον εκαμετε, και κατεκαυσα αυτον εν πυρι και συνετριψα αυτον και κατελεπτυνα αυτον εωσου εγεινε λεπτον ως σκονη· και ερριψα την σκονην τουτου εις τον χειμαρρον τον καταβαινοντα απο του ορους.

22 Και εν Ταβερα και εν Μασσα και εν Κιβρωθ-αττααβα παρωργισατε τον Κυριον.

23 Και οτε ο Κυριος σας απεστειλεν απο Καδης-βαρνη, λεγων, Αναβητε και κληρονομησατε την γην, την οποιαν εδωκα εις εσας, τοτε σεις εστασιασατε εναντιον της προσταγης Κυριου του Θεου σας, και δεν επιστευσατε εις αυτον ουδε εισηκουσατε της φωνης αυτου.

24 Παντοτε εστασιασατε εναντιον του Κυριου, αφ' ης ημερας σας εγνωρισα.

25 Και προσεπεσον ενωπιον του Κυριου τεσσαρακοντα ημερας και τεσσαρακοντα νυκτας, καθως προσεπεσον προτερον· διοτι ο Κυριος ειπε να σας εξολοθρευση.

26 Και εδεηθην του Κυριου λεγων, Κυριε Θεε, μη εξολοθρευσης τον λαον σου και την κληρονομιαν σου, τον οποιον ελυτρωσας δια της μεγαλωσυνης σου, τον οποιον εξηγαγες εξ Αιγυπτου εν χειρι κραταια·

27 ενθυμηθητι τους δουλους σου, τον Αβρααμ, τον Ισαακ και τον Ιακωβ· μη επιβλεψης εις την σκληροτητα του λαου τουτου, μητε εις τας ασεβειας αυτων, μητε εις τας αμαρτιας αυτων·

28 μηπως ειπωσιν οι κατοικοι της γης, εκ της οποιας εξηγαγες ημας, Επειδη ο Κυριος δεν ηδυνατο να εισαγαγη αυτους εις την γην, την οποιαν υπεσχεθη προς αυτους, και επειδη εμισει αυτους, εξηγαγεν αυτους δια να φονευση αυτους εν τη ερημω·

29 αλλ' ουτοι ειναι λαος σου και κληρονομια σου, τους οποιους εξηγαγες με την δυναμιν σου την μεγαλην και με τον βραχιονα σου τον εξηπλωμενον.

350. Of the tribe of Judah twelve thousand were sealed. (7:5) This symbolizes celestial love, which is love toward the Lord, and this in all those people who will be in the Lord's New Heaven and New Church.

In the highest sense Judah symbolizes the Lord in relation to celestial love; in the spiritual sense, the Lord's celestial kingdom and the Word; and in the natural sense, the doctrine of a celestial church drawn from the Word. Here, however, Judah symbolizes celestial love, which is love toward the Lord; and because it is named first in the series, it symbolizes that love in all those people who will be in the New Heaven and in the Lord's New Church. For the tribe named first is everything in the rest, being to them as though their head and serving as a universal property entering into all those that follow, tying them together, qualifying them and affecting them. This property is love toward the Lord.

To be shown that twelve thousand symbolizes all who possess that love, see no. 348 above.

[2] People know that after the death of Solomon the twelve tribes of Israel were divided into two kingdoms: the kingdom of Judah and the kingdom of Israel. The kingdom of Judah represented the celestial kingdom or the Lord's priestly kingdom, while the kingdom of Israel represented the spiritual kingdom or the Lord's royal kingdom. But the latter was destroyed when the people had nothing spiritual left in them, whereas the kingdom of Judah was preserved, for the sake of the Word, and because the Lord would be born there. However, when the people adulterated the Word completely, and thus could not recognize the Lord, then their kingdom was destroyed.

It can be seen from this that the tribe of Judah symbolizes celestial love, which is love toward the Lord. But because the people were of the character they were with respect to the Word and with respect to the Lord, the tribe of Judah symbolizes also the opposite love, which is love of self - properly speaking, a love of dominating springing from a love of self - a love which we call diabolical love.

[3] The fact that Judah and his tribe symbolize the celestial kingdom and its love, which is love toward the Lord, follows from these passages:

Judah, your brothers shall praise you... The scepter shall not be taken from Judah... until Shiloh comes; and to Him shall be the obedience of the people. Binding his donkey's foal to the vine, his donkey's colt to the choice vine, he washes his garment in wine... His eyes are redder than wine, and his teeth whiter than milk. (Genesis 49:8-12)

...David shall be their prince forever, and I will make a covenant of peace with them; it shall be an everlasting covenant with them..., and I will set My sanctuary in their midst forevermore. (Ezekiel 37:25-26)

Exult and rejoice, O daughter of Zion! ...Jehovah will make Judah an inheritance for Himself, His portion on the holy land. (Zechariah 2:10-12)

O Judah, celebrate your feasts, perform your vows. For Belial 1 shall no more pass through you; he is utterly cut off. (Nahum 1:15)

The Lord... will suddenly come to His temple... Then the offering of Judah and Jerusalem will be sweet to Jehovah as in the days of old... (Malachi 3:1, 4)

Judah shall abide forever, and Jerusalem from generation to generation. (Joel 3:20)

Behold, the days are coming..., that I will raise to David a righteous Branch... In His days Judah will be saved... (Jeremiah 23:5-6)

I will bring forth offspring from Jacob, and from Judah an heir of My mountains, that My elect may possess it... (Isaiah 65:9)

Judah became His sanctuary, and Israel His dominion. (Psalms 114:2)

Behold, the days are coming..., when I will make a new covenant... with the house of Judah... ...this will be the covenant...: I will put My law within them, and write it on their heart... (Jeremiah 31:27, 31, 33-34)

In those days ten men... shall grasp the sleeve of a Jewish man, saying, "We will go with you, for we have heard that God is with you." (Zechariah 8:23)

...as the new heavens and the new earth which I will make shall remain before Me..., so shall your offspring and your name remain.

Kings (of the nations) shall be your foster fathers, their princesses your nursing mothers. They shall bow down to you, their faces to the ground, and lick the dust of your feet. (Isaiah 66:22; 49:23)

[4] From these and many other passages, which we do not have the space to cite because of their number, it can be clearly seen that Judah means not Judah but the church. We are told, for example, that the Lord would make a new and eternal covenant with that nation, that He would make it His heir and His sanctuary forevermore, and that kings of the nations and their princesses would bow down to them, licking the dust of their feet, and so on.

[5] That the tribe of Judah, regarded in itself, means the diabolic kingdom, which is one of a love of dominating springing from a love of self, can be seen from the following passages:

I will hide My face from them, I will see what their posterity will be. ...they are a perverse generation, children in whom is no faith... ...they are a nation void of counsel... ...their vine is of the vine of Sodom and of the fields of Gomorrah; its grapes are grapes of gall, their clusters are bitter. Their wine is the poison of dragons, and the cruel venom of asps. Is this not laid up in store with Me, sealed up in My treasuries? (Deuteronomy 32:20-34)

(Know that) it is not because of your righteousness or the uprightness of your heart... that Jehovah... is... giving you (the land of Canaan)..., for you are a stiff-necked people. (Deuteronomy 9:5-6)

...according to the number of your cities have been your gods, O Judah... ...according to the number of the streets of Jerusalem you have set up altars... to burn incense to Baal. (Jeremiah 2:28; 11:13)

You are of your father the devil, and you choose to do the desires of your father. (John 8:44)

Jews are said to be full of hypocrisy, iniquity, and uncleanness (Matthew 23:27-28.
